AI-extracted from the 10-Q filed 2026-08-06 — Q2 FY2026 (quarter ended June 30, 2026). Every figure is machine-verified against the filing text on SEC EDGAR.
Net income attributable to Nelnet fell 63% YoY to $66.7M, mainly because Q2 2025 included a one-time $175.0M ALLO investment gain, even as core net interest income rose 21% to $96.0M.
Interest expense fell on a lower average debt balance and lower cost of funds, partially offset by higher interest expense on larger Nelnet Bank deposit balances.
Includes LSS, ETSP, and reinsurance revenue; prior-year period included a $175.0M gain on partial redemption of the ALLO investment not repeated in 2026.
